Timeline

  1. Waymo robotaxis launch on Lyft app in Nashville

    Lyft begins commercial driverless robotaxi operations, with Flexdrive managing vehicle readiness, maintenance, and depot operations.

  2. Lyft sells Level 5 to Woven Planet

    Lyft divests its autonomous vehicle unit to Toyota's Woven Planet Holdings subsidiary for $550 million, exiting in-house AV development.

Lyft's $550M AV Exit Positions Flexdrive as Robotaxi Fleet Operator

Lyft's Flexdrive unit is now the operational backbone for Waymo's robotaxi launch in Nashville, handling vehicle readiness, maintenance, infrastructure, and depot operations. For logistics leaders, this marks a tangible shift from ride-hailing software to physical fleet management. The $550 million sale of Lyft's Level 5 unit in 2021 signaled the pivot—now supplier relationships, depot real estate, and maintenance workflows become the competitive moat.
